## Onboarding: Schema Registry Access

Welcome aboard. As a contractor on the Lanternfold event platform, you'll register and version event schemas through the Driftgate registry. Compatibility checks run automatically on every schema push. If you're ever locked out of the registry admin console, use the emergency recovery flow with the passphrase below.

vault phrase of fafop-kagug = zorox-zorwyn

## Data Stores: Autocomplete Index

Welcome aboard. The Quillbrook autocomplete index lives in a dedicated search cluster, separate from the main catalog database. It has been slow since the Tindermere launch because prefix queries bypass the trigram cache; a rebuild is scheduled but not yet prioritized. As a contractor, please test queries against staging only, and keep result limits under 50 to avoid timeouts. Warm-up scripts live in the tools repo. For staging access, the cluster accepts connections via the string below.

replica DSN, haweg-fajog: cockroachdb://silael_svc:onzs1oy@db-61f1.ordincloud.internal:5432/ulaath

**Key Ceremony Checklist — Item 7: Incremental Rebuild Signing Key**

Before rotating the signing key for Lanternmoss incremental static site rebuilds, confirm that the partial-rebuild cache on the Fennick build cluster has been fully flushed, that no rebuild jobs are mid-flight, and that both ceremony witnesses have initialed the log sheet. Re-enable the rebuild webhook only after the new key is verified against a clean full build. Should the ceremony vault refuse the new key, unseal it using the recovery passphrase recorded below.

vault phrase of bagaf-kajeg = jorath-feniel-briir-siliel-ralix

Handover: Pulsegrid telemetry compression. We moved the ingest path from raw JSON to delta-encoded batches with zstd level 6, cutting payload size roughly 70%. Note the schema version header must stay backward-compatible for two releases. Tests live in the compaction suite; run them before any codec change. Direct all codec questions to the engineer named below.

named custodian: Brivan Eliath Quenox Frador